[vectorIntrinsics+mask] RFR: Merge panama-vector:vectorIntrinsics [v2]

Xiaohong Gong xgong at openjdk.java.net
Tue Jul 27 01:00:21 UTC 2021


> Hi, could anyone please take a look at this simple merge? Thanks!
> 
> This patch merges the latest vectorIntrinsics into vectorIntrinsics+mask, with resolving the conflicts in `"src/hotspot/cpu/aarch64/register_aarch64.hpp"`.
> 
> Tested tier1 and jdk:tier3.

Xiaohong Gong has updated the pull request with a new target base due to a merge or a rebase. The pull request now contains 13 commits:

 - Merge branch 'panama-vector:vectorIntrinsics' into vectorIntrinsics+mask
 - 8270264: Add the masking support for vector lanewiseShift
   
   Reviewed-by: jbhateja, psandoz
 - 8266287: Basic mask IR implementation for the Vector API masking feature support
   
   Reviewed-by: sviswanathan
 - 8269282: Add masking support for vector gather_load/scatter_store
   
   Reviewed-by: jbhateja
 - 8269343: Masked vector arithmetic intrinsics failed to be inlined randomly
   
   Reviewed-by: psandoz
 - 8267368: Add masking support for reduction vector intrinsics
   
   Reviewed-by: psandoz
 - 8268154: Add masking support for vector load intrinsics
   
   Reviewed-by: jbhateja, psandoz
 - Merge panama-vector:vectorIntrinsics
 - Merge panama-vector:vectorIntrinsics
   
   Reviewed-by: njian
 - 8266621: Add masking support for unary/ternary vector intrinsics
   
   Reviewed-by: psandoz, vlivanov
 - ... and 3 more: https://git.openjdk.java.net/panama-vector/compare/a0f9d863...93805a00

-------------

Changes: https://git.openjdk.java.net/panama-vector/pull/102/files
 Webrev: https://webrevs.openjdk.java.net/?repo=panama-vector&pr=102&range=01
  Stats: 7123 lines in 78 files changed: 5372 ins; 641 del; 1110 mod
  Patch: https://git.openjdk.java.net/panama-vector/pull/102.diff
  Fetch: git fetch https://git.openjdk.java.net/panama-vector pull/102/head:pull/102

PR: https://git.openjdk.java.net/panama-vector/pull/102


More information about the panama-dev mailing list